Grass Glue for electrostatic flocking with the NOCH "Gras-Master" (250 ml)
NOCH "Grass Glue" was specially developed for electrostatic flocking with the NOCH "Gras-Master". Compared to normal white glue, NOCH "Grass Glue" has a lower surface tension and sets more slowly – the grass fibres are therefore surrounded by the glue bed and remain upright in it. This process makes for a super realistic result... just like the original!
Because the "Grass Glue" sets more slowly, larger areas can be covered with grass and over a longer period.
Note: NOCH Grass Glue dries transparent.
Grass Glue for creative crafting, decoration and architectural model making. The tub contains 250 g of adhesive, which can be removed with a paintbrush and applied to the surface. The glue dries transparent. It’s therefore advisable to prime the area to be grassed beforehand with light green Acrylic Paint (ref. 61194). You’ll get a beautiful meadow with upright blades of grass if you blow NOCH kreativ Grass Fibres (e.g. ref. 08310) into the glue with the Puffer Bottle (ref. 08100). It then looks like a fluffy, soft, fresh meadow!
However, you can also spread the glue on many other surfaces, such as card, glass, plastic and wood and apply the fluffy flakes with the Puffer Bottle. This gives you velvety surfaces and allows you to design very special DIY projects.
